Step 1: Assessment and Risk Assessment
Our team arrives quickly to assess the situation. We identify the source of the leak, the extent of the damage, and any potential hazards. With years of experience, we know exactly what to look for and how to focus on the job.
Step 2: Water Extraction and Drying
We use specialized equipment to extract as much water as possible from the affected area. Our team then sets up dehumidifiers and fans to speed up the drying process. This is where most DIY tries go wrong, they don’t have the right equipment or expertise to get the job done right.
Step 3: Cleanup and Sanitization
With the water removed and the area dry, we focus on cleanup and sanitization. We’ll scrub away any remaining debris, disinfect the area, and return it to its original condition. This is often the most time-consuming part of the process, but our team is up to the task.
Step 4: Repair and Restoration
Finally, we’ll repair any damaged cabinetry, fixtures, or other parts. We work closely with you to ensure the final result meets your expectations. From subtle refinishing to full replacement, we’ll get your kitchen looking and functioning like new.

Under-Cabinet Water Extraction Cost in Centreville, VA
The cost of under-cabinet water extraction services in Centreville, VA, can vary depending on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ions. These estimates are based on real-world scenarios and can serve as a rough guideline.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Initial Assessment and Risk Assessment | $100 – $500 | Severity of damage, size of affected area |
| Water Extraction and Drying |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, equipment needed |
| Cleanup and Sanitization | $200 – $1,000 | Size of affected area, level of contamination |
| Repair and Restoration | $1,000 – $5,000 | Severity of damage, materials needed |
| Disinfection and Odor Removal | $100 – $500 | Severity of odor, level of contamination |
| Final Inspection and Certification | $50 – $200 | Size of affected area, level of damage |
